Output b33aa602293a3cd1b52ff62efd6a0c27889f8fb28eb25842658c05d7af19ab81:67

value
1036000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41d9b57e513e4e02743afade4a6480f3fb7d1ec7 OP_EQUAL
address
37hCehLqpvES5aVEkR4mP9h3xRZMR4fjWt
transaction
b33aa602293a3cd1b52ff62efd6a0c27889f8fb28eb25842658c05d7af19ab81
spent
true